Overview Table
Here’s a quick snapshot of the key specs to give you an idea at a glance:
| Feature | Details |
|---|---|
| Model Name | EcoZoom Pro |
| Battery Capacity | 4 kWh Lithium-Ion |
| Range | Up to 250 km per charge |
| Top Speed | 60 km/h |
| Charging Time | 4-5 hours (standard outlet) |
| Weight | 85 kg |
| Colors Available | Black, Blue, Red |
| Warranty | 3 years on battery, 2 on motor |
| Price | Starting at Rs 39,999 |
Design & Style
The design is sleek and modern, nothing too flashy but practical for daily use. It has a compact body with LED headlights that give it a sharp look at night. The seat is comfy for two, with enough space under it for helmets or groceries. Weighing just 85 kg, it’s easy to maneuver in tight spots. Available in three colors – black for that stealth vibe, blue for fun, and red if you want to stand out. It’s not trying to be a sports bike; it’s more like your reliable city companion.
Engine & Performance
Okay, it’s electric, so no traditional engine, but the motor packs a punch. A 2.5 kW brushless DC motor delivers smooth acceleration without any noise or vibrations. You hit 0-40 km/h in about 5 seconds, which is quick enough for urban roads. The battery is a removable 4 kWh lithium-ion unit, making it easy to charge at home or swap if needed. Performance-wise, it handles inclines well, thanks to the torque that kicks in instantly. No more worrying about gear shifts – just twist and go.
Ride & Handling
Riding this scooter feels effortless. The suspension is telescopic at the front and coil spring at the rear, soaking up potholes without much hassle. Brakes are disc on both wheels with regenerative tech that adds a bit more range while stopping. Handling is stable, even at top speed of 60 km/h, and the tubeless tires grip the road nicely. It’s great for beginners or commuters who want something forgiving in traffic.
Features & Tech
It’s loaded with basics that matter. Digital display shows speed, battery level, and trip info. There’s USB charging for your phone, anti-theft alarm, and even a find-my-scooter app integration. Safety features include side stand sensor and low battery alerts. No fancy AI stuff, but it’s got what you need for everyday rides.
Mileage & Fuel Efficiency
The star here is the 250 km range – perfect for long commutes without recharging daily. In eco mode, you can stretch it further; sport mode dials it back a bit for more power. Efficiency is around 25-30 paise per km, way cheaper than petrol scooters. Charging is simple via any plug, and it supports fast charging options.
